Answer:

x < -2 or x ≥ 4

Explanation:

We have a closed circle at 4 which means equals

The line goes to the right which means greater than

x ≥ 4

We have an open circle at -2 and the line goes to the left which means less than

x < -2

They are not connected which means or

x < -2 or x ≥ 4
